Our Lady of Loreto and the Continual Graces of the Annunciation, by  Donald Jacob Uitvlugt 

By Donald Jacob Uitvlugt, Catholic World Report - (Dec. 10th) marks an important Marian feast arising from the devotional life of the Church and especially of the lay faithful, the feast of Our Lady of Loreto. Traditional accounts report that, on December 10, 1394, the small house in which the Virgin Mary had lived was transported by angels to the small town of Loreto (in central Italy, not too far from the Adriatic)... Much ink has been spilled, especially in modern times, over whether the stone structure housed in the Basilica della Santa Casa is or is not the structure in which the Annunciation occurred. One is not required to believe that the walls within the basilica were transported by angels, or indeed was the house of the Annunciation at all ....

The Lost Boys and the Failure of Our Institutions, by Scott Ventureyra

By Scott Ventureyra, Crisis Magazine - Yet the real wound is not only that these boys are drifting into harder and more chaotic spaces online. The deeper wound is that most Christian leaders have offered them nothing stronger or more hopeful to cling to. Too many churches adopt a soft managerial tone instead of demonstrating genuine pastoral courage. Too many pastors behave like administrators when the moment demands fathers. These young men do not need to be analyzed, reprimanded, or told they are a problem. They need direction. They need presence. They need someone willing to stand in the gap.

The Blessing of Reconciling a Past Abortion Later in Life, by Kevin & Theresa Burke

By Kevin & Theresa Burke, Catholic Exchange - The U.S. abortion ratio reached its peak in 1984, with 364 abortions for every 1,000 live births.  This generation with the highest abortion rates in our nation’s history are entering their golden years.  This provides an opportunity for the Church to share a message of reconciliation, hope, and healing... Eileen Kuhlmann has been a leader for many years in an abortion healing ministry in the Dallas archdiocese.  Eileen shared the story of Joanne: “An 87-year-old woman reached out to me with a desire to heal of a past abortion.  She simply said, ‘It is time.’”
